Ringing the Bells for Holiday Hopes
Russ Baldwin | Nov 04, 2013 | Comments 0
The Lamar Ministerial Alliance and Salvation Army is seeking volunteers to ring the bells during the holiday season donation drive.
Volunteers will spend two hours on weekends between November 29 and December 23 in front of various shopping areas in Lamar. Their bell ringing will be the focal point for persons to offer cash contributions for the needy during the holidays. John Maxwell of the Lamar Compassion Center said the goal is up to $20,000 this year. “Last year the volunteers collected about $15,000 and we’d like to be able to increase that if we can,” he stated.
The hours of sign-up will run from 8am to 6pm at most locations on Friday, Saturday and Sunday, depending on store hours. Some outlets, he said, will be open later than others so the volunteers may stay longer at those stores.
The locations are Safeway, Wal Mart, ALCO, Thriftway and The Dollar Store. Folks who want to sign up for their two hour shift can do so at lamarcobellringers@gmail.com.
